#996968 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#996968 is composed of 60% red, 41.2%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 31.4% magenta, 32%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 1.2 degrees, a saturation of 19.4% and a lightness of 50.4%. #996968 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d2d0 with #330000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#996968 color description : Mostly desaturated dark red.
#996968 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#996968 has RGB values of R:153, G:105,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.32,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 10053992.

Shades and Tints of #996968
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f8f5f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#996968
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#867c7b is the less saturated color, while #fa0c07 is the most saturated one.
